Pentachlorotoluene: Rotational and Compositional Disorder

C. P. Brock and Y. Fu

Abstract: The structure of pentachlorotoluene, which is isostructural with most other C6Cln(CH3)6-n derivatives, has been redetermined at 294 (1) K. The methyl group is distributed almost randomly among six sites; there is little discrimination between the Cl and CH3 substituents. The TL thermal-motion description suggests that the in-plane libration is moderate ( <\psi2> = 13 deg2); the barrier to in-plane rotation is estimated as 35 (3) kJ mol-1. Compositional disorder is a possibility.
